The Mathematics Behind Pushing Your Luck
One of the most intriguing aspects of cool math push your luck games is the application of probability theory. Each decision to “push” involves weighing the odds of success against the potential consequences of failure. Here’s what makes the math so compelling:
- Expected Value: Players calculate the average outcome of continuing versus stopping. This helps determine if the risk is statistically worth it.
- Risk Assessment: Understanding the probability of failure on the next move allows players to make informed decisions.
- Game Theory: In multiplayer versions, predicting opponents’ behaviors adds another layer of strategic complexity.
For instance, if you’re playing a dice-based PUSH YOUR LUCK GAME, knowing the chances of rolling a safe number versus a losing number can guide your choice to either roll again or bank your points.

Using Probability to Your Advantage
Imagine a game where you roll a die, and if you roll a 1, you lose everything. Rolling any other number increases your score. The probability of losing on the next roll is 1/6, or about 16.7%. If your current score is high, pushing your luck could be risky. But if you have a low score, the potential reward might justify the risk.
Understanding these probabilities helps you make calculated decisions rather than relying purely on intuition or impulse.
Popular Cool Math Push Your Luck Games to Try
If you’re eager to experience the thrill of push your luck mechanics combined with cool math concepts, here are some popular games to explore:
- Can't Stop: A classic dice game where players roll dice and try to advance on numbered tracks without getting “stopped.” It’s a perfect example of risk versus reward.
- Incan Gold (also known as Diamant): A card game where players explore temples and must decide whether to continue digging for treasure or escape before hazards end their turn.
- Push Your Luck Online Games: Websites like Coolmath Games offer digital versions of push your luck games, often with math puzzles integrated into the gameplay.
- Zombie Dice: Players keep rolling dice to collect brains without getting shot. It’s simple, fast-paced, and heavily reliant on luck and strategy.
